M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the slab. This mixture typically consists of a combination of water, soil, and cement, which is pumped into voids underneath the concrete to raise it back to its original position. The procedure is often used as a cost-effective alternative to replacing damaged or settled concrete, helping to restore the stability and appearance of the surface with minimal disruption.
This service addresses common problems associated with uneven or sunken concrete slabs, such as trip hazards, water pooling, and structural instability. Over time, soil erosion, settling, or shifting beneath a concrete slab can cause it to sink or crack, leading to safety issues and aesthetic concerns. Mudjacking can effectively fill voids and lift the slab, reducing the risk of accidents and preventing further deterioration. It also helps improve drainage and prevents water from pooling, which can cause additional damage to the property.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 for standard residential projects. Larger or more complex jobs can reach up to $3,000 or more,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Factors Affecting Price - The size of the area to be lifted and the condition of the existing concrete influence costs. For example, a small driveway may be on the lower end, while a large patio could be more expensive.
Average Cost per Square Foot - The average cost for mudjacking is approximately $3 to $6 per square foot. Prices may vary based on local labor rates and material costs in Dunedin, FL and nearby areas.
